Apartments vs Villas: Best Property Type to Buy in Dubai in 2025?
Before we explore the top neighborhoods to buy in Dubai, let’s address an important question for any investor: Should you invest in an apartment or a villa in Dubai this year?
Apartments continue to lead in popularity and performance. They made up 76% of all residential transactions in early 2025 and offer an average rental return of 5.24%. Apartments are generally more affordable, easier to maintain, and work well for short-term rentals, especially in high-demand areas. If you’re looking to maximize ROI on Dubai properties, studios and one-bedroom apartments in central locations are a smart option.
Villas, on the other hand, have shown impressive growth. In Q1 2025, villa sales jumped over 80%. These properties offer more space, privacy and are ideal for families or long-term residents. They also show strong property price growth in Dubai, especially in newer or developing areas.
So, which one should you choose?
- For steady rental income: Apartments are your go-to, particularly in tourist or business hubs.
- For long-term value growth, Villas in affordable areas in Dubai with development potential offer better appreciation.
- For balanced returns: Two-bedroom apartments in established communities can give you the best of both worlds.

Downtown Dubai – A Prime Place to Buy Property in Dubai
Downtown Dubai is more than just an address; it’s a symbol of luxury. Located near Sheikh Zayed Road and Financial Centre Road, this district features iconic landmarks like Burj Khalifa, Dubai Mall, and the Dubai Fountain. The community is split into two distinct zones: Old Town with traditional low-rise Arabian buildings, and New Town with modern high-rise towers.
This central location offers excellent convenience, luxury, and access to fine dining, top hospitals, international schools, and 5-star hotels. It’s also one of the most visited places in the city, making it a top performer for short-term rental investments in Dubai.
Here’s why Downtown Dubai remains one of the best areas to invest in Dubai property:
- The planned “Downtown Circle” will add a futuristic architectural icon
- High tourist footfall supports excellent ROI on short stays
- Prestige and centrality ensure solid long-term value
- Minimal commute times appeal to professional tenants
Investment figures show why it’s still in high demand. In 2024, average prices reached AED 2,710 per sq. ft, marking a 6% increase from 2023. Over 4,436 property transactions were recorded, totaling AED 14 billion. Rental yields range from 5.5% to a high 12.07%, particularly for studios and one-bed units. Jumeirah Village Circle (JVC)
Jumeirah Village Circle (JVC) is one of the top-performing affordable areas in Dubai for real estate investors in 2025. It recorded over 2,200 apartment sales in March 2025 alone, making it the highest among all Dubai districts. Property prices remain attractive, averaging AED 1,282 per sq. ft for apartments and AED 1,373 per sq. ft for villas. These prices provide a great entry point for investors who want strong rental returns.
When you search for “why invest in JVC,” you’ll see affordability and ROI mentioned often. Rental returns are among the best in the city, ranging from 7% to 14% for apartments and 6.16% to 21.5% for villas. Rental rates jumped 16.2% in 2024, with studios renting for AED 49,000 to AED 60,000 per year.
Key reasons why JVC is one of the best areas to invest in Dubai property:
- It’s centrally located between Al Khail Road and Sheikh Mohammed Bin Zayed Road
- Continuous development improves infrastructure and community features every year
- The price-to-rent ratio remains highly favorable for landlords
- Popular with young professionals and small families, ensuring consistent tenant demand

Dubai Hills Estate
Dubai Hills Estate continues to be one of Dubai’s most in-demand areas in 2025. In 2024 alone, there were over 7,397 property transactions worth AED 23.4 billion. This shows the community’s strong appeal for both investors and end-users.
Developed by Emaar and Meraas, this master-planned area offers modern villas, townhouses, and apartments. It’s also home to an 18-hole championship golf course, making it one of the top golf communities in the city. Located next to Al Barsha South and along Al Khail Road, Dubai Hills spans more than 11 million square meters and includes around 20 sub-communities.
What sets Dubai Hills apart is its combination of nature, luxury, and lifestyle:
- Panoramic golf course views and lush parks
- 54 km of dedicated cycling tracks
- Dubai Hills Mall with 2.5 million sq. ft. of retail space
Investment returns remain good here. Villas yield between 5.21% and 7.19%, while apartments offer even more, between 5.58% and 7.98%. Rental prices went up 33.8% in 2024, making it the top performer among villa communities.
Why Dubai Hills Estate is one of the best areas to invest in Dubai property:
- Attracts high-income families and long-term residents
- Excellent schools and healthcare facilities nearby
- A balanced mix of apartments and villas creates a strong rental market
- Premium address leads to high property values and rental income

Dubai South – One of the Best Emerging Places to Buy Property in Dubai
Dubai South is shaping up to be one of the most promising real estate investment areas in Dubai. In 2024, the area saw 5,778 transactions totaling AED 12.1 billion. Located near Al Maktoum International Airport, Dubai South is being developed as a fully integrated city with residential, commercial, and industrial districts. The entire project spans 145 square kilometers.
The government is investing heavily in this region, and its transformation is already underway. The legacy of Expo 2020 lives on here, with the former site now converted into District 2020, a tech-forward commercial and innovation hub.
Why Dubai South is one of the best areas to invest in Dubai property:
- The expansion of Al Maktoum Airport will create thousands of jobs
- District 2020 will even increase business activity and rental demand in the region
- Government-backed infrastructure drives long-term growth
- Property is still affordable, offering room for capital appreciation
Rental returns in Dubai South are among the highest in the city. Apartments deliver yields between 7.5% and 9.5%, while townhouses offer between 6.5% and 8.5%. In fact, rental prices hiked by 24% in 2024, more than any other area in Dubai.

Dubai Maritime City
Dubai Maritime City (DMC) is one of the most exciting waterfront developments in Dubai. Located between Port Rashid and Drydocks World, it blends residential, commercial, and maritime-focused zones across 2.27 million square meters. Designed as a global maritime hub, DMC is now gaining attention as a prime Dubai property investment location.
With its unique zoning plan, DMC is not just for marine businesses. It includes high-rise towers, luxury apartments, hotels, and retail spaces, making it attractive to both investors and residents. Its location close to Downtown Dubai and Sheikh Zayed Road ensures great connectivity to the rest of the city.
Why Dubai Maritime City is one of the best areas to invest in Dubai property:
- Waterfront living with uninterrupted sea views
- High-end mixed-use towers offer both residential and investment potential
- Growing infrastructure and developer interest from brands like Danube and Omniyat
- Central location near Mina Rashid, Sheikh Zayed Road, and Downtown Dubai
The area is still in a growth phase, which means property prices remain competitive. This opens the door for capital appreciation as more towers are completed and handed over. Investors can also expect high rental demand due to the scenic location and proximity to business districts.
